The Most Striking Contrasts
- Sensory Experience: Burkina Faso is a feast of vibrant colors, the smell of dust and rain, and the sounds of bustling markets. Guernsey is an experience of muted coastal hues, the scent of sea salt, and the sound of waves and seagulls.
- Economic Foundation: Burkina Faso's livelihood is tied to the earth—its cotton fields and gold mines. Guernsey's prosperity is built on finance, insurance, and a reputation for stability, making it a haven for capital rather than a source of raw materials.
- Concept of Community: In Burkina Faso, community is a wide, interconnected web of family and ethnic ties, essential for survival and celebration. In Guernsey, community is smaller, more intimate, and built around parish life and a shared island identity.
- Relationship with the World: Burkina Faso is a landlocked heart of a continent, deeply involved in regional African affairs. Guernsey is an island looking outward to the sea, historically connected to both Britain and France, but fiercely independent in spirit.

The Tourist Experience
Tourism in Burkina Faso is an expedition. It’s about discovering the surreal beauty of the Karfiguéla Waterfalls after a long drive, bartering for bronze statues in a dusty market, and feeling the deep history of the Loropéni Ruins. It’s an immersion. Tourism in Guernsey is a picturesque holiday. It’s about exploring the charming capital of St. Peter Port, reading a book in Victor Hugo’s garden, and cycling along quiet country lanes. It’s a retreat.
